Beauty Brands with a Sustainable Commitment in Canada

I used to LOVE makeup. I would go out and buy a new lipstick or a new foundation every month. Nowadays, I spend more time at home and I prefer using minimal make-up. However, I like dressing up and putting on some makeup when I am going for a date with my husband or when we go to an event.

I now try to choose the makeup that has minimal plastic packaging and the brand is sustainable.

I put together a list of 24 beauty brands from right here in Canada that I like and I think you will enjoy as well.

Founder Leah Black began Cheeks Ahoy after having her first child. As a new mother, she was eager to practice sustainability with cloth diapers. Even though she was eliminating waste on one end, she was still exposing herself to a large amount of single-use wipes after each diaper change - including the plastic packaging that wipes came in. 

She found success making wipes on her own out of old flannel bed sheets and before long, other moms started to order from her. With the help of a team of local moms (and a dad) they now fulfill orders using sustainable fabrics from their hometown and have expanded their products beyond baby wipes.

Founded in British Columbia, Elate Cosmetics is dedicated to transforming the face of sustainable makeup with innovative products. Their focus is on helping you create a customized capsule makeup collection that will minimize your beauty regimen. 

Their packaging is biodegradable, inserts are refillable, and their ingredients are 90% organic (if necessary, fair trade is selected over organic). Through their entire supply chain, the brand prioritizes ethical and fair practices.

Everist is a zero waste salon grade hair care brand. With more than three times the potency of traditional formulas, it has the same amount of cleansing and conditioning power as a traditional 300 mil shampoo or conditioner, which requires about 30 washes depending on your hair style. With its concentrated formula and smaller size, this product is more eco-friendly to ship, while its waterless formula eliminates all preservatives.

Suncoat's founder Yingchun Liu, was inspired by her daughter's fascination with nail polish. Yingchun knew of the harmful chemicals found in conventional polish like formaldehyde, toluene, and acetate from her educational and working background in chemistry. So she set out to create a solution. The water-based, non-toxic polish formulations and manufacturing are located here in Ontario, Canada.
